From 01c464f9b1cdb31de77f31b4e7b9e7beeba6a720 Mon Sep 17 00:00:00 2001 From: ZhaoTongYao <531131322@qq.com> Date: Wed, 20 Jan 2021 09:17:25 +0800 Subject: [PATCH] =?UTF-8?q?=E6=8B=BC=E5=9B=A2=E8=B4=AD=E5=A2=9E=E5=8A=A0?= =?UTF-8?q?=E6=88=AA=E6=AD=A2=E6=97=B6=E9=97=B4=EF=BC=9B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- pages/toRegister/toRegister.js | 2 +- .../pages/groupBuyDetail/groupBuyDetail.js | 10 ++- .../pages/groupBuyDetail/groupBuyDetail.wxml | 9 +++ .../pages/groupBuyList/groupBuyList.wxml | 2 +- .../pages/groupBuyList/groupBuyList.wxss | 3 + .../pages/groupBuyListMy/groupBuyListMy.wxml | 2 +- .../pages/groupBuyListMy/groupBuyListMy.wxss | 3 + .../pages/groupBuyPublish/groupBuyPublish.js | 62 +++++++++---------- .../groupBuyPublish/groupBuyPublish.wxml | 12 ++-- utils/config.js | 4 +- 10 files changed, 66 insertions(+), 43 deletions(-) diff --git a/pages/toRegister/toRegister.js b/pages/toRegister/toRegister.js index df2cdb4..601188b 100644 --- a/pages/toRegister/toRegister.js +++ b/pages/toRegister/toRegister.js @@ -21,7 +21,7 @@ Page({ // } // }) let that = this - const versionNum = "1.6.17" + const versionNum = "1.6.18" api.getScanSwitch(versionNum).then(function (res) { console.log(res.data) let state = res.data.scanFlag diff --git a/subpages/heart/pages/groupBuyDetail/groupBuyDetail.js b/subpages/heart/pages/groupBuyDetail/groupBuyDetail.js index b28aab0..1084010 100644 --- a/subpages/heart/pages/groupBuyDetail/groupBuyDetail.js +++ b/subpages/heart/pages/groupBuyDetail/groupBuyDetail.js @@ -208,14 +208,18 @@ Page({ if (this.data.lock) { return false } - //状态0:进行中 5:已结束 10:已取消 - if (e.currentTarget.dataset.groupbuystatus != 0) { + //状态0:进行中 4: 已截至 5:已结束 10:已取消 + if (e.currentTarget.dataset.groupbuystatus != 0 && e.currentTarget.dataset.groupbuystatus != 4) { return false } //提交 报名状态0:报名 10:取消报名 let status = 0 //当前 报名状态0:未报名 1:已报名 2:交易已确认 - if (e.currentTarget.dataset.status == 1) { + if (e.currentTarget.dataset.status == 0) { + if (e.currentTarget.dataset.groupbuystatus == 4) { + return + } + } else if (e.currentTarget.dataset.status == 1) { status = 10 } else if (e.currentTarget.dataset.status == 2) { return diff --git a/subpages/heart/pages/groupBuyDetail/groupBuyDetail.wxml b/subpages/heart/pages/groupBuyDetail/groupBuyDetail.wxml index 04d24d5..3ff7107 100644 --- a/subpages/heart/pages/groupBuyDetail/groupBuyDetail.wxml +++ b/subpages/heart/pages/groupBuyDetail/groupBuyDetail.wxml @@ -23,6 +23,12 @@ + + 截止时间 + + {{details.groupBuyEndTime}} + + 报名人数 @@ -31,6 +37,9 @@ + + + diff --git a/subpages/heart/pages/groupBuyList/groupBuyList.wxml b/subpages/heart/pages/groupBuyList/groupBuyList.wxml index 5bb3a0b..2c4516c 100644 --- a/subpages/heart/pages/groupBuyList/groupBuyList.wxml +++ b/subpages/heart/pages/groupBuyList/groupBuyList.wxml @@ -14,7 +14,7 @@ 置顶 - {{item.groupBuyStatus == '0' ? '团购中' : '已结束'}} + {{item.groupBuyStatus == '0' ? '团购中' : item.groupBuyStatus == '4' ?'已截团' : item.groupBuyStatus == '5' ?'已结束' : '已取消'}} {{item.groupBuyPublishTime}} diff --git a/subpages/heart/pages/groupBuyList/groupBuyList.wxss b/subpages/heart/pages/groupBuyList/groupBuyList.wxss index 1d96b99..45625bf 100644 --- a/subpages/heart/pages/groupBuyList/groupBuyList.wxss +++ b/subpages/heart/pages/groupBuyList/groupBuyList.wxss @@ -89,6 +89,9 @@ page { .tag-5 { color: #E30000; } +.tag-4 { + color: #7561E0; +} .tag-10 { color: #999999; } diff --git a/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xml b/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xml index 0c2f57b..3788a27 100644 --- a/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xml +++ b/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xml @@ -21,7 +21,7 @@ {{item.groupBuyTitle}} - {{item.groupBuyStatus == '0' ? '团购中' : item.groupBuyStatus == '5' ? '已结束' : '已取消'}} + {{item.groupBuyStatus == '0' ? '团购中' : item.groupBuyStatus == '4' ? '已截团' : item.groupBuyStatus == '5' ? '已结束' : '已取消'}} {{item.groupBuyPublishTime}} 评价 diff --git a/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xss b/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xss index 90d6e8c..0d39923 100644 --- a/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xss +++ b/subpages/heart/pages/groupBuyListMy/groupBuyListMy.wxss @@ -135,6 +135,9 @@ page { .tag-0 { color: #00A066; } + .tag-4 { + color: #7561E0; + } .tag-5 { color: #E30000; } diff --git a/subpages/heart/pages/groupBuyPublish/groupBuyPublish.js b/subpages/heart/pages/groupBuyPublish/groupBuyPublish.js index e60b9fb..3d033fc 100644 --- a/subpages/heart/pages/groupBuyPublish/groupBuyPublish.js +++ b/subpages/heart/pages/groupBuyPublish/groupBuyPublish.js @@ -16,7 +16,7 @@ Page({ id: '', //主键 更新时携带 groupBuyTitle: '', //标题 groupBuyContent: '', //内容 - // groupBuyTime: '', //团购时间 + groupBuyEndTime: '', //截止时间 groupBuyMobile: '', //手机 groupBuyPriceNumber: [ { @@ -140,32 +140,32 @@ Page({ 'dataForm.groupBuyPriceNumber': this.data.dataForm.groupBuyPriceNumber }) }, - // pickerCancel () { - // console.log('取消日期选择') - // this.setData({ - // showPicker: false, - // 'dataForm.groupBuyTime': '' - // }) - // }, - // pickerConfirm (e) { - // console.log('选择日期', e.detail.time) - // if (e.detail.time < getTimestamp()) { - // this.showToast("团购时间应该大于当前时间") - // } else { - // this.setData({ - // showPicker: false, - // 'dataForm.groupBuyTime': e.detail.time - // }) - // } - // }, - // //日期选择插件显示入口 - // selectTime (e) { - // this.data.showPicker = !this.data.showPicker - // this.setData({ - // showPicker: this.data.showPicker, - // 'dataForm.groupBuyTime': this.data.dataForm.groupBuyTime || getTimestamp() - // }) - // }, + pickerCancel () { + console.log('取消日期选择') + this.setData({ + showPicker: false, + 'dataForm.groupBuyEndTime': '' + }) + }, + pickerConfirm (e) { + console.log('选择日期', e.detail.time) + if (e.detail.time < getTimestamp()) { + this.showToast("截止时间应该大于当前时间") + } else { + this.setData({ + showPicker: false, + 'dataForm.groupBuyEndTime': e.detail.time + }) + } + }, + //日期选择插件显示入口 + selectTime (e) { + this.data.showPicker = !this.data.showPicker + this.setData({ + showPicker: this.data.showPicker, + 'dataForm.groupBuyEndTime': this.data.dataForm.groupBuyEndTime || getTimestamp() + }) + }, //发布 submitApply () { if (this.data.lock) { @@ -179,10 +179,10 @@ Page({ this.showToast("标题限制在50字以内") return false } - // if (!this.data.dataForm.groupBuyTime) { - // this.showToast("请填写团购时间") - // return false - // } + if (!this.data.dataForm.groupBuyEndTime) { + this.showToast("请填写截止时间") + return false + } if (!this.data.dataForm.groupBuyContent) { this.showToast("请填写团购内容") return false diff --git a/subpages/heart/pages/groupBuyPublish/groupBuyPublish.wxml b/subpages/heart/pages/groupBuyPublish/groupBuyPublish.wxml index eaebf86..c7ca9b3 100644 --- a/subpages/heart/pages/groupBuyPublish/groupBuyPublish.wxml +++ b/subpages/heart/pages/groupBuyPublish/groupBuyPublish.wxml @@ -35,7 +35,11 @@ - + + + 截止时间 + {{dataForm.groupBuyEndTime||'请选择时间'}} + 联系电话 @@ -49,8 +53,8 @@ - + + + diff --git a/utils/config.js b/utils/config.js index d2e0a8b..e11d713 100644 --- a/utils/config.js +++ b/utils/config.js @@ -6,8 +6,8 @@ module.exports = { }; function BASEURL() { - // return 'https://epdc-jinan-test.elinkservice.cn/js/epdc-api/api/' // 锦水测试环境 - return 'https://epdc-jinshui.elinkservice.cn/epdc-api/api/' // 锦水正式环境接口地址 + return 'https://epdc-jinan-test.elinkservice.cn/js/epdc-api/api/' // 锦水测试环境 + // return 'https://epdc-jinshui.elinkservice.cn/epdc-api/api/' // 锦水正式环境接口地址 // return 'http://192.168.43.8:9094/epdc-api/api/' }